Army General’s Coop and Versus Modes
As it says on the tin, the Army General’s upcoming Coop and Versus update will allow you to play any Army General campaign with or against other human players. It will retroactively apply to Bruderkrieg, already featured in WARNO, but will be - of course - a standard setting with the launch of the remaining Army General campaigns.
There will be some restrictions to both the Versus and Coop mode.
Four human players max.
Three human players top on the same side.
In Coop, all players will be able to perform all the game’s actions. So, be sure to be on the same page and have a plan - hence “cooperation,” commanders.
Once a battle is met in Army General, but before a tactical game is launched, players can distribute the battalions among them. Then, if needed, you’ll be able to switch companies from one to another to make things more balanced. Note that battles featuring fewer companies than human players on one side will be autoresolved.
Command & Control
What’s the new Command & Control (C2) setting? In short, the more units you call in as reinforcements, the less income you get. It is an “upkeep” system adapted to WARNO, bringing several key elements:
First, it offers the advantage of letting commanders focus more on the tactical aspect of the game. It limits the number of units a commander can control on the battlefield at any time. This is especially useful for players wanting to deal with fewer units simultaneously.
Another element is that it releases players from constantly bringing reinforcements to use up their Command points. As we know, in a regular game, you are forced to spend your points as fast as possible; otherwise, you’ll field fewer units than an opponent, which puts you at a disadvantage.
Lastly, the new setting prevents an over-dominant player from increasing their lead during a battle in an insurmountable way, giving a real chance for the underdog to make a comeback.
A Setting Not a New Game Rule
Command & Control is a setting, not a new game rule. It can be applied on top of the classic Conquest and Destruction Combat Rules, only affecting the players’ income, not the victory conditions.
Your income is reduced by an amount of Command Points equivalent to a percentage of the cost of each unit deployed on the battlefield. Hence, the more units called in, the less income. Currently, we have three settings: 0% (no upkeep, the current setting), 5%, and 7%.
There are a few caveats:
LOG units are not counted in this upkeep. This means that maintaining your logistic lines will be crucial in the battle. As the famous quote goes, “Amateurs talk strategy, professionals talk logistics.”
AIR upkeep is half that of ground units, regardless of the setting you choose.
You can’t accumulate more than 5.000 Command Points.
The new Command & Control setting will be included in the next milestone BERNADOTTE, both available in Skirmish and multiplayer game creation lobbies (but not in Ranked). We will also convert 10vs10 lobbies to feature this new setting.

<Stamina Recovery System>
This system will make the battles in BATTLE CRUSH, where stamina management is crucial, even more exciting and enjoyable.
It is designed to ensure that players who actively attack can reap significant benefits without the combat becoming overly defensive/passive.
Moreover, it provides advantages for players pursuing an opponent trying to flee!
So, what has been added?
1. The stamina recovery rate has increased! 2. A stamina bubble has been added to help with stamina recovery.
Let’s take a look at what stamina bubbles are.
● Consuming a stamina bubble immediately recovers up to 40% of your maximum stamina! ● A stamina bubble will appear in front of you when you knock an enemy away to a distance of 15m or more!
However, there are notes to be aware of:
● Stamina bubbles disappear 5 seconds after they appear. You’ll need to act fast! ● Once a stamina bubble is generated, there is a cooldown of 20 seconds before the next one appears. (It looks like it will be important to strategize, right?) ● The bubbles you create are visible only to you, so you will be the only one who can collect them!
The next improvement we'll introduce is related to stagger.
< Changes Related to Stagger>
● A cooldown on stagger from the initial light hit has been added. To explain, there is a stagger once you get hit. However, this cooldown means that additional hits will not cause an accumulation of stagger after the stagger from the initial light hit until the cooldown is over.
● We expect this improvement to prevent situations such as when players are unable to respond due to being infinitely stun-locked when hit by multiple enemies at once.
To sum up, the stamina recovery rate has increased, the stamina bubble system has been added, and a cooldown on stagger from additional hits has been applied.
